终极指南:用FanControl解决Windows风扇控制难题,告别显卡转速异常
【免费下载链接】FanControl.ReleasesThis is the release repository for Fan Control, a highly customizable fan controlling software for Windows.项目地址: https://gitcode.com/GitHub_Trending/fa/FanControl.Releases
FanControl是一款功能强大的Windows风扇控制软件,专为硬件爱好者和追求完美散热静音平衡的用户设计。这款免费开源工具通过高度自定义的风扇曲线和智能温控算法,让你完全掌控电脑硬件的散热性能。无论你是遭遇显卡风扇转速异常、NvApiWrapper兼容性问题,还是想要优化整体散热方案,本指南将为你提供完整的解决方案和深度配置技巧。
问题痛点:为什么你的风扇控制总是失灵?
当你在Windows系统上尝试精确控制风扇转速时,是否遇到过这些令人沮丧的情况?😤
显卡风扇转速失控:明明设置了平滑的温控曲线,风扇却突然飙升至最高转速,噪音如同飞机起飞。状态切换延迟长达5-10秒:调整风扇模式后需要异常漫长的等待才能生效,严重影响使用体验。休眠唤醒后控制完全失效:电脑从休眠状态恢复后,风扇控制软件就像失忆了一样,再也无法重新接管风扇。RTX系列显卡的"30%转速锁定":部分RTX 30/40系列显卡无论如何设置都无法将转速降至30%以下,静音效果大打折扣。
这些问题的根源往往不是你的硬件故障,而是Windows系统底层风扇控制机制的局限性。传统的BIOS风扇控制过于简单粗暴,而显卡厂商自带的控制软件又缺乏灵活性。FanControl正是为了解决这些痛点而生,它通过更精细的底层接口和智能算法,为你提供专业级的散热控制方案。
FanControl vs. 其他工具:为什么选择它?
在众多风扇控制工具中,FanControl凭借其独特优势脱颖而出:
与主板BIOS控制相比:BIOS控制通常只有几个预设档位(静音、标准、性能),无法根据实时温度动态调整。FanControl支持完全自定义的温度-转速曲线,让你在散热和噪音之间找到完美平衡点。
与显卡厂商软件相比:NVIDIA GeForce Experience和AMD Adrenalin虽然提供风扇控制功能,但选项有限且缺乏跨硬件整合能力。FanControl可以同时控制CPU、GPU、机箱风扇,实现全局散热协调。
与其他第三方工具相比:许多开源风扇控制工具要么界面简陋,要么功能单一。FanControl拥有现代化的Material Design界面,支持插件扩展,社区活跃,更新频繁。
图1:FanControl主界面展示了风扇控制的核心功能区域,包括实时监控和曲线配置
核心功能全景:FanControl的六大核心模块
1. 实时监控与控制面板
FanControl的左侧导航栏提供了直观的功能分区,包括Home(主页)、Theme(主题)、Tray Icons(托盘图标)、Settings(设置)和About(关于)。主控制面板分为四个关键区域:
- Controls(控制)模块:显示GPU、CPU Push、CPU Pull、Front Top等风扇的实时状态,包括当前转速(RPM)、百分比、以及步进参数(Step up/down)、启动/停止阈值等
- Curves(曲线)模块:以图表形式展示风扇转速与温度的关系,支持多曲线叠加和混合计算
- Temperature Sources(温度源):支持CPU核心平均温度、GPU温度、主板温度、硬盘温度等多种温度源
- Trigger(触发)系统:基于温度阈值触发特定的风扇行为,如空闲温度、满载温度、响应时间等
2. 智能风扇曲线编辑器
这是FanControl最强大的功能之一。通过点击曲线卡片上的"Edit"按钮,你可以进入图形化的曲线编辑器:
- 多点曲线控制:在温度-转速坐标图上添加多个控制点,创建任意形状的响应曲线
- 函数类型选择:支持线性、指数、对数等多种函数类型,满足不同散热需求
- 混合曲线功能:可以将多个温度源的曲线混合计算,实现更智能的控制逻辑
3. 高级参数微调
对于追求极致控制的用户,FanControl提供了丰富的微调参数:
- Step up/down(步进速率):控制风扇转速变化的平滑度,避免突然的转速跳跃
- Start/Stop %(启动/停止阈值):设置风扇启动和停止的临界点,避免风扇在低负载时频繁启停
- Hysteresis(滞后参数):防止风扇在温度临界点附近频繁切换状态
- Response time(响应时间):控制风扇对温度变化的反应速度
4. 配置文件管理系统
FanControl支持保存、编辑和加载多个配置文件,让你可以为不同使用场景创建专门的散热方案:
- 游戏模式:激进的风扇曲线,确保高负载下的稳定散热
- 工作模式:平衡散热和噪音,创造安静的工作环境
- 静音模式:优先考虑噪音控制,适合夜间或安静环境使用
- 自动切换:可以根据运行的程序自动切换配置文件
5. 插件生态系统
通过插件系统,FanControl可以扩展支持更多硬件设备。官方和社区提供了丰富的插件:
- 硬件厂商插件:支持Intel ARC GPU、Dell笔记本、Thermaltake设备、ASUS主板等
- 监控软件集成:与HWInfo、GPU-Z、AIDA64等监控软件的数据集成
- 智能家居联动:通过HomeAssistant插件与智能家居系统联动
6. 主题与界面定制
FanControl支持深色/浅色主题切换,还可以自定义界面颜色,让你的控制面板既实用又美观。
实战应用场景:三种典型配置方案
场景一:游戏玩家的高性能散热方案
对于游戏玩家来说,稳定的散热性能直接影响游戏体验和硬件寿命。以下是最佳配置方案:
温度源选择:GPU温度作为主温度源,CPU温度作为辅助温度源风扇曲线设置:在60°C以下保持低转速(30-40%),60-80°C线性提升至70%,80°C以上全速运行响应时间:设置为"快速"(1秒),确保游戏负载变化时风扇能及时响应滞后参数:设置为3°C,避免温度小幅波动导致风扇频繁变速
场景二:内容创作者的静音工作环境
视频编辑、3D渲染等创作工作对静音要求较高,同时需要稳定的散热:
温度源选择:CPU核心平均温度作为主温度源风扇曲线设置:采用更平缓的曲线,在70°C以下保持40-50%转速,70-85°C缓慢提升至70%步进速率:降低步进速率(+3%/sec,-2%/sec),使转速变化更平滑触发系统:设置空闲温度35°C,空闲风扇速度30%,创造安静的工作环境
场景三:服务器/NAS的7×24小时稳定运行
对于需要持续运行的设备,散热稳定性和噪音控制同样重要:
温度源选择:硬盘温度和CPU温度双重监控风扇曲线设置:采用保守的曲线,确保温度始终在安全范围内最低转速设置:设置30%的最低转速,确保空气持续流动配置文件备份:定期备份配置文件,防止意外丢失
个性化深度定制:高级功能详解
1. 自定义避免区域(Avoid Regions)
最新版本的FanControl引入了"避免区域"功能,这是解决特定转速区间共振噪音的神器:
工作原理:某些风扇在特定转速区间(如1200-1400 RPM)会产生共振噪音或异常振动。通过设置避免区域,你可以让风扇快速跳过这些"问题区间"。
配置方法:
- 进入风扇曲线编辑器
- 点击"Advanced"(高级)选项卡
- 在"Avoid Regions"(避免区域)部分添加要跳过的转速区间
- 设置过渡斜率,控制跳过速度
实际应用:如果你的机箱风扇在45-50%转速区间有共振,可以设置45-50%为避免区域,风扇会快速通过这个区间,停留在更稳定的转速上。
2. 多风扇协调控制
当系统中有多个风扇时,协调控制至关重要:
主从控制模式:将一个风扇设置为"主风扇",其他风扇跟随其转速变化温度加权平均:根据不同硬件的发热量,为各个温度源分配不同的权重延迟启动策略:设置次要风扇在主风扇达到一定转速后才启动,减少同时启动的电流冲击
3. 基于应用程序的自动切换
通过第三方工具(如AutoHotkey)配合FanControl的配置文件切换功能,可以实现基于运行程序的自动散热策略切换:
游戏启动时:自动切换到高性能散热配置文件视频渲染时:切换到平衡散热配置文件待机状态时:切换到静音配置文件
性能优化锦囊:10个实用技巧
技巧1:正确设置BIOS基础配置
在开始使用FanControl之前,确保BIOS设置正确:
- 将风扇控制模式设置为PWM(脉宽调制)而非DC(直流电压)
- 禁用BIOS的"智能风扇控制"功能
- 设置一个适中的基础风扇速度(如40%)
技巧2:温度传感器选择策略
不同的温度传感器适用于不同的控制场景:
- CPU核心温度:最准确反映CPU实际温度,适合CPU风扇控制
- GPU核心温度:适合显卡风扇控制
- 主板温度传感器:适合机箱风扇控制
- 硬盘温度:适合NAS或存储服务器的风扇控制
技巧3:曲线平滑度优化
过于陡峭的曲线会导致风扇频繁变速,影响使用寿命:
- 在温度变化平缓的区域使用更平缓的曲线斜率
- 在临界温度点附近增加控制点密度
- 使用指数曲线而非线性曲线,获得更自然的响应
技巧4:响应时间与滞后平衡
响应时间和滞后参数需要平衡设置:
- 游戏PC:较短的响应时间(1-2秒),较小的滞后(2-3°C)
- 工作站:中等响应时间(3-5秒),中等滞后(3-5°C)
- 静音设备:较长的响应时间(5-10秒),较大的滞后(5-7°C)
技巧5:多配置文件管理
为不同使用场景创建专门的配置文件:
- 使用有意义的命名,如"Gaming_Performance"、"Work_Silent"
- 定期备份配置文件到云存储或外部设备
- 创建季节性的配置文件,夏季使用更激进的散热策略
技巧6:监控与日志分析
启用FanControl的调试日志功能:
- 定期检查事件日志,发现异常模式
- 监控风扇启动/停止频率,优化阈值设置
- 记录温度峰值和风扇响应,分析散热效果
技巧7:插件选择与配置
根据硬件选择合适的插件:
- NVIDIA显卡用户:确保NvApiWrapper插件正确安装和配置
- 多硬件用户:考虑使用混合插件方案
- 定期更新插件,获取更好的兼容性和新功能
技巧8:系统集成优化
将FanControl更好地集成到系统中:
- 设置开机自启动,确保控制持续有效
- 配置系统托盘图标,快速访问常用功能
- 创建桌面快捷方式,方便配置文件切换
技巧9:定期维护计划
建立定期维护习惯:
- 每月检查一次风扇曲线设置
- 每季度清理一次风扇和散热器灰尘
- 每半年更新一次FanControl和插件版本
技巧10:社区资源利用
积极参与FanControl社区:
- 在GitHub Issues中寻找常见问题的解决方案
- 参考其他用户的配置文件设置
- 分享自己的配置经验,帮助其他用户
疑难杂症速查:常见问题解决方案
问题1:FanControl启动后无法检测到风扇
可能原因:
- 没有以管理员权限运行
- LibreHardwareMonitor未正确安装
- 硬件不支持或需要特定插件
解决方案:
- 右键点击FanControl.exe,选择"以管理员身份运行"
- 检查设备管理器中是否有未知设备
- 查看官方文档中的硬件兼容性列表
- 尝试安装对应的硬件插件
问题2:风扇转速显示但不响应控制
可能原因:
- BIOS风扇控制模式冲突
- 风扇曲线设置有误
- 硬件限制(如最低转速限制)
解决方案:
- 进入BIOS,将风扇控制模式改为PWM
- 检查风扇曲线是否设置了合理的值
- 重置配置文件,重新配置风扇控制
问题3:NVIDIA显卡风扇控制异常
可能原因:
- NVIDIA驱动版本兼容性问题
- NvApiWrapper状态切换失败
- 显卡BIOS限制
解决方案:
- 尝试使用NVIDIA驱动466.77版本(兼容性最佳)
- 在FanControl设置中启用"NVIDIA兼容性模式"
- 调整重试次数为3,超时时间为1000毫秒
- 参考官方Wiki中的[NVIDIA 30%和0 RPM问题指南]
问题4:软件启动后立即崩溃
可能原因:
- 配置文件损坏
- .NET Framework运行环境问题
- 系统权限冲突
解决方案:
- 删除配置文件(位于
%APPDATA%\FanControl) - 重新安装最新版本的.NET Framework
- 以安全模式启动,排除软件冲突
问题5:风扇控制休眠后失效
可能原因:
- 系统休眠时驱动程序被卸载
- FanControl服务未正确恢复
- 硬件重新初始化问题
解决方案:
- 在电源选项中禁用"选择性暂停USB设备"
- 设置FanControl为系统服务而非用户程序
- 创建休眠唤醒后的自动重启脚本
问题6:多风扇协调问题
可能原因:
- 风扇响应特性不同
- 曲线设置冲突
- 温度源选择不当
解决方案:
- 为每个风扇单独校准响应曲线
- 使用主从控制模式协调多个风扇
- 选择恰当的温度源,避免相互干扰
总结展望:打造完美的散热控制系统
FanControl不仅仅是一个风扇控制软件,它是一个完整的散热管理生态系统。通过本指南的深度解析,你应该已经掌握了从基础配置到高级定制的全方位技能。
核心价值总结:
- 精准控制:告别BIOS的粗糙控制,实现毫米级精度调整
- 智能协调:多风扇智能协调,提升整体散热效率
- 高度可定制:丰富的参数和插件系统,满足各种特殊需求
- 持续进化:活跃的社区和频繁的更新,确保软件与时俱进
未来发展方向: 随着硬件技术的不断发展,FanControl也在持续进化。未来的版本可能会加入AI智能调优、云端配置文件同步、跨平台支持等新功能。无论你是硬件发烧友、游戏玩家还是专业内容创作者,FanControl都能为你提供专业级的散热控制方案。
记住,良好的散热控制不仅能提升硬件性能和使用寿命,还能显著改善使用体验。通过正确的配置和维护,你的电脑将变得更加安静、高效、可靠。现在就开始使用FanControl,打造属于你的完美散热系统吧!🚀
最后提醒:在调整风扇设置时,请始终监控硬件温度,确保在安全范围内操作。如有不确定的地方,建议从保守的设置开始,逐步优化。祝你配置顺利,享受安静高效的电脑使用体验!
【免费下载链接】FanControl.ReleasesThis is the release repository for Fan Control, a highly customizable fan controlling software for Windows.项目地址: https://gitcode.com/GitHub_Trending/fa/FanControl.Releases
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考